Just as the winter seems like it can’t get any darker, any rainier, any cloudier, any gloomier, suddenly it’s late January and the sun comes out and stays out for a few days. It’s light out when I wake up in the morning and dusk doesn’t come so early. The crocuses come up (I saw my first two days ago), and our lilac tree shows the first hint of buds. In Vancouver, it’s not unreasonable to develop some healthy spring fever before February.
